2027: APC Lacks Strength to Deliver Bayelsa for Tinubu Alone, PDP Claims

The Peoples Democratic Party Chairman in Bayelsa State, George Turnah, has challenged the claim by the state chapter of the All Progressives Congress that it has enough grassroots support to deliver President Bola Tinubu in the state in the 2027 presidential election.

Turnah, in a statement issued by his Senior Special Assistant on Media and Communication, Kelvin Loveday-Egbo, said the APC’s claim should be assessed against the voting pattern recorded during the 2023 presidential election.

He argued that the results from the 2023 election showed that the PDP and Labour Party collectively secured more votes in Bayelsa than the APC.

According to him, the PDP polled 65,145 votes, while the Labour Party and APC recorded 45,645 and 40,417 votes respectively.

Turnah said the figures demonstrated the political relevance of the PDP and the emerging Rainbow Coalition ahead of the 2027 election.

He also argued that the political situation in Bayelsa had changed since 2023, particularly following the emergence of Peter Obi as the presidential candidate of the Nigeria Democratic Congress.

The PDP chairman said the APC should not dismiss the Rainbow Coalition, which he described as a potential source of additional political support for Tinubu across party lines.

He maintained that the support of the PDP and the coalition would be important to any effort to secure Tinubu’s support in Bayelsa.

Turnah urged the APC leadership to consider the realities on the ground ahead of the 2027 election, while assuring that the PDP would continue strengthening its structures and engaging its members across the state.

The comments followed recent claims by the Bayelsa APC chairman, Warman Ogoriba, that the party had established structures across all eight local government areas and political wards in the state and was confident in its grassroots strength ahead of the election.
